Ryman Auditorium – Venue for Live Music

In the heart of Nashville, Tennessee, stands the impressive Ryman Auditorium, also known as the "Mother Church of Country Music." This historic venue is famous for its exquisite live music performances and attracts thousands of visitors each year. The auditorium has unparalleled acoustics and offers an intimate atmosphere, making it one of the best places for concerts in the United States.

History

The Ryman Auditorium was originally opened in 1892 as a meeting house for the First Baptist Church of Nashville. Over the years, the auditorium evolved into one of the most important venues for country music, hosting legendary artists. The venue was home to the "Grand Ole Opry," one of the oldest and most recognized country music shows, for almost an entire century. The historically rich setting and beautifully adorned walls tell stories of how country music originated and which significant artists performed here.

Events and Tours

The Ryman Auditorium is not just a place for concerts; it also offers daily tours that give visitors a behind-the-scenes look. During the tour, you will gain insights into the exciting history of the auditorium and admire various exhibits and memorabilia of famous artists. In addition to regular events, seasonal events are held that cover a variety of musical genres, from classic country to rock and folk.

Visitor Information

Visitors report consistently positive experiences. Many are thrilled by the warm and inviting atmosphere, while others praise the exceptional acoustics. It seems there isn't a bad seat in the auditorium, whether in the balcony or the front rows. A minor criticism mentioned by some is the comfort of the wooden benches, which may not provide the best support for longer concerts. Nevertheless, the excitement for the top-notch performances and the impressive historical charm of the venue prevails.
